Monthly Airbnb Revenue Variations & Income Potential in Sugar City (2025)
Understanding the monthly revenue variations for Airbnb listings in Sugar City is key to maximizing your short term rental income potential. Seasonality significantly impacts earnings. Our analysis, based on data from the past 12 months, shows that the peak revenue month for STRs in Sugar City is typically July, while January often presents the lowest earnings, highlighting opportunities for strategic pricing adjustments during shoulder and low seasons. Explore the typical Airbnb income in Sugar City across different performance tiers: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ve $3,109+ monthly, often utilizing dynamic pricing and superior guest experiences.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) earn $1,702 or more, indicating effective management and desirable locations/amenities.
- Typical properties (Median) generate around $1,042 per month, representing the average market performance.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) see earnings around $669, often with potential for optimization.

Airbnb Seasonality Analysis & Trends in Sugar City (2025)
Peak Season (July, August, September)
- Revenue averages $2,142 per month
- Occupancy rates average 54.8%
- Daily rates average $233
Shoulder Season
- Revenue averages $1,296 per month
- Occupancy maintains around 32.5%
- Daily rates hold near $191
Low Season (January, February, October)
- Revenue drops to average $1,037 per month
- Occupancy decreases to average 25.8%
- Daily rates adjust to average $172
Seasonality Insights for Sugar City
- The Airbnb seasonality in Sugar City shows highly seasonal trends requiring careful strategy. While the sections above show seasonal averages, it's also insightful to look at the extremes:
- During the high season, the absolute peak month showcases Sugar City's highest earning potential, with monthly revenues capable of climbing to $2,545, occupancy reaching a high of 62.3%, and ADRs peaking at $235.
- Conversely, the slowest single month of the year, typically falling within the low season, marks the market's lowest point. In this month, revenue might dip to $972, occupancy could drop to 18.1%, and ADRs may adjust down to $141.
- Understanding both the seasonal averages and these monthly peaks and troughs in revenue, occupancy, and ADR is crucial for maximizing your Airbnb profit potential in Sugar City.

Sugar City STR Booking Lead Time Analysis (2025)
Average Booking Lead Time by Month
Booking Lead Time Insights for Sugar City
- The overall average booking lead time for vacation rentals in Sugar City is 42 days.
- Guests book furthest in advance for stays during June (average 74 days), likely coinciding with peak travel demand or local events.
- The shortest booking windows occur for stays in October (average 20 days), indicating more last-minute travel plans during this time.
- Seasonally, Summer (59 days avg.) sees the longest lead times, while Fall (34 days avg.) has the shortest, reflecting typical travel planning cycles.
